Apple Watch History and Evolution
The Apple Watch first made its debut in 2015, marking Apple's official entry into the wearable technology market. Since its inception, it has transformed from a supplementary device to an indispensable digital companion. Initially, Apple positioned the watch as a luxury item, with its first edition offering a gold variant that cost upwards of $10,000. However, over time, Apple has adjusted its strategy to appeal to a broader audience by introducing more affordable models.
Throughout its evolution, the Apple Watch has seen significant upgrades in both hardware and software capabilities. With each new series, Apple has improved the device's health monitoring features, such as heart rate tracking, ECG, and blood oxygen levels, as well as introducing fitness tracking, GPS, and cellular connectivity. The introduction of watchOS has further enhanced the user experience, offering a seamless interface and integration with other Apple devices.
Apple's strategy of launching multiple series with varying features and price points has broadened its appeal. The Series 1 through 7 offered incremental improvements, while the Series 8, SE, and Ultra have provided more distinct differences in performance and functionality. This diversity allows users to select a watch model that best fits their lifestyle and budgetary needs.

Factors Influencing Apple Watch Cost
The cost of an Apple Watch is influenced by a variety of factors that affect its final retail price. One of the primary determinants is the model and series of the watch. Each series comes with its own set of features, materials, and technologies, all of which contribute to its price point. The latest series typically include advanced features such as improved health monitoring, longer battery life, and enhanced display technology, which can increase the cost.
Materials play a significant role in determining the Apple Watch's cost. Watches made with premium materials such as stainless steel, titanium, or ceramic are priced higher than those made with aluminum. The choice of band also impacts the price, with leather or stainless steel bands costing more than the standard sport bands.
Technological advancements and features also contribute to the price. Features such as cellular connectivity, GPS, and advanced health sensors add to the watch's cost. The inclusion of these features allows users to use their watch independently from their iPhone, which can be a significant selling point for many customers.
Another factor influencing cost is the geographical market. Prices can vary based on location due to differences in taxes, import duties, and currency exchange rates. Additionally, Apple may price their watches differently in various markets to account for local purchasing power and competition.

How to Save on Your Apple Watch Purchase
For those looking to purchase an Apple Watch without breaking the bank, there are several strategies to save money on the purchase. By taking advantage of discounts, promotions, and alternative options, consumers can find a watch that fits their budget.
One of the best ways to save money on an Apple Watch is to look for sales and promotions. Apple occasionally offers discounts on its products, especially during major shopping events such as Black Friday or Cyber Monday. Additionally, authorized Apple retailers may offer their own discounts, providing further opportunities to save.
Another option is to consider purchasing a previous-generation model. As new models are released, older versions often receive price reductions. While these models may not have all the latest features, they still offer excellent functionality and value for money.
Buying a second-hand or refurbished Apple Watch is another way to save money. Refurbished watches are typically inspected and certified by Apple or authorized sellers, ensuring they are in good working condition. These watches are often sold at a lower price than new models, providing a cost-effective alternative for budget-conscious consumers.
Finally, consider purchasing the watch with a financing or payment plan. Many retailers offer interest-free payment options, allowing consumers to spread the cost of the watch over several months. This approach can make the purchase more manageable and reduce the immediate financial burden.

Apple Watch Cost Compared to Competitors
The Apple Watch is often compared to other smartwatches on the market, with price being a significant factor in these comparisons. While the Apple Watch is generally more expensive than many of its competitors, it offers a range of features and benefits that justify its higher price for many users.
One of the main competitors to the Apple Watch is the Samsung Galaxy Watch. The Galaxy Watch offers similar features, including health monitoring, GPS, and cellular connectivity, often at a lower price point. However, the Apple Watch is known for its seamless integration with other Apple devices, which is a significant advantage for those already invested in the Apple ecosystem.
Another competitor is the Fitbit smartwatch range, which is known for its fitness-focused features and affordability. While Fitbit watches offer excellent health and fitness tracking, they may lack some of the advanced features and connectivity options available in the Apple Watch.
Garmin is another popular brand in the smartwatch market, known for its rugged and durable designs. Garmin watches are often geared towards outdoor enthusiasts and athletes, offering extensive GPS and fitness tracking features. While they can be more expensive than some other competitors, they may not offer the same level of connectivity and app support as the Apple Watch.
